mis⋅spell⋅ing

[mis-spel-ing]
–noun
1. the act of spelling incorrectly: Note his misspelling of that word.
2. an incorrectly spelled word: You have three misspellings in your letter.

Origin:
1685–95; mis- 1 + spelling

mis⋅spell

[mis-spel]
–verb (used with object), verb (used without object), -spelled or -spelt, -spell⋅ing.
to spell incorrectly.

Origin:
1645–55; mis- 1 + spell 1
